




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
车辆租赁管理系统课程设计引言车辆租赁管理系统概述车辆租赁管理系统需求分析车辆租赁管理系统设计车辆租赁管理系统实现车辆租赁管理系统测试与评估总结与展望contents目录01引言培养解决问题能力课程设计要求学生分析问题、设计系统架构、实现功能并测试,从而培养他们的问题解决能力和创新思维。增强团队协作能力在课程设计中,学生需要分组进行,共同完成系统开发,这有助于培养他们的团队协作和沟通能力。实践应用通过实际开发一个车辆租赁管理系统,学生能够将理论知识应用于实践中,提升编程技能和系统开发能力。课程设计的目的和意义文档编写学生需要编写详细的系统文档,包括系统使用手册、系统维护手册等。系统测试学生需要对系统进行全面的测试,确保系统的稳定性和可靠性。编程实现学生需要使用合适的编程语言和技术实现系统的各个功能模块。需求分析学生需要对车辆租赁业务进行深入了解,明确系统的功能需求和性能要求。系统设计学生需要设计出合理的系统架构,包括数据库设计、界面设计、系统流程设计等。课程设计的任务和要求02车辆租赁管理系统概述随着城市化进程加速和交通拥堵问题日益严重,越来越多的人开始选择租赁车辆而非购买。未来,车辆租赁市场将朝着更加便捷、智能和环保的方向发展,满足用户多样化的出行需求。当前车辆租赁市场发展迅速,尤其在共享经济背景下,汽车共享和分时租赁模式逐渐兴起。车辆租赁市场的现状和发展趋势03系统采用智能化的管理方式,实现车辆的远程监控、调度和自助取还车等功能。01车辆租赁管理系统具备车辆管理、订单处理、用户管理、财务管理等功能模块。02系统支持多种租赁方式,如长期租赁、短期租赁、按需租赁等,满足不同用户的需求。车辆租赁管理系统的功能和特点适用于汽车租赁公司、共享汽车平台以及个人车主等不同应用场景。系统需满足用户快速预约、支付、续租、退租等操作需求,提供便捷的租车服务体验。对于租赁公司而言,系统有助于提高车辆利用率、降低运营成本并增强管理效率。车辆租赁管理系统的应用场景和用户需求03车辆租赁管理系统需求分析
用户需求分析用户类型分析不同类型用户(如租赁客户、管理员、系统维护人员等)的需求和权限,以便设计不同用户界面和功能。用户操作流程梳理用户在系统中的操作流程,包括租车、还车、车辆查询、订单管理等功能流程。用户体验关注用户在使用系统过程中的体验,包括界面设计、操作便捷性、信息呈现方式等方面。对车辆信息进行录入、查询、修改和删除等操作,确保车辆信息准确无误。车辆管理实现租赁订单的生成、查询、修改和取消等功能,满足租赁客户的需求。租赁管理根据租赁时间和车辆类型等条件计算租赁费用,支持多种支付方式。费用结算提供各类报表,如车辆使用情况统计、费用结算报表等,方便管理员进行数据分析。报表统计功能需求分析系统性能采取必要的安全措施,保护用户数据和系统数据的安全。数据安全系统可维护性系统可扩展性01020403系统应具备可扩展性,以适应未来业务发展和功能增强的需求。确保系统能够快速响应各类操作,满足高并发访问需求。系统应具备良好的可维护性,方便管理员进行日常维护和升级。非功能需求分析04车辆租赁管理系统设计分层架构系统采用典型的三层架构,包括数据访问层、业务逻辑层和表示层。模块化设计各层内部采用模块化设计,便于系统的维护和扩展。接口定义各层之间通过清晰的接口定义进行交互,确保系统的模块化。系统架构设计关系型数据库采用关系型数据库管理系统,如MySQL或Oracle。数据表设计根据业务需求设计数据表,包括车辆信息表、租赁信息表等。索引优化合理使用索引,提高数据库查询效率。系统数据库设计界面设计简洁明了,易于用户操作。用户友好支持多种屏幕尺寸,满足不同用户的需求。响应式布局采用现代设计风格,提升用户体验。美观大方系统界面设计实现对车辆的基本信息、位置、状态等进行管理。车辆管理模块处理租赁订单、计费、结算等业务逻辑。租赁管理模块管理用户账户、权限等信息。用户管理模块提供各类报表,帮助管理者进行决策分析。统计分析模块系统功能模块设计05车辆租赁管理系统实现系统开发环境与工具前端框架Bootstrap、Vue.js等数据库管理系统MySQL、Oracle等开发语言Java、Python等后端框架Spring、Django等集成开发环境(IDE)Eclipse、PyCharm等系统开发编写代码,实现系统功能。需求分析明确系统功能需求,进行用户调研和需求分析。系统设计设计系统架构、数据库结构、界面布局等。系统测试进行单元测试、集成测试和系统测试,确保系统稳定性和可靠性。系统部署与维护部署系统至服务器,进行系统维护和升级。系统开发方法和流程实现用户注册、登录、信息修改等功能。用户管理模块车辆管理模块租赁管理模块报表统计模块实现车辆信息录入、查询、修改和删除等功能。实现租赁订单生成、订单查询、订单结算等功能。实现租赁数据统计、财务报表生成等功能。系统关键功能模块的实现06车辆租赁管理系统测试与评估对每个模块进行单独测试,确保每个模块的功能正常。单元测试将所有模块集成在一起进行测试,确保模块之间的协调和整体功能的完整性。集成测试模拟实际使用场景,对系统进行全面的测试,确保系统满足用户需求。验收测试在修复bug或增加新功能后,重新进行测试,确保修改不会引入新的问题。回归测试系统测试方案与过程响应时间评估系统对请求的响应速度,优化系统性能以减少响应时间。吞吐量评估系统在单位时间内处理请求的能力,优化系统以提升吞吐量。资源利用率评估系统对硬件资源的占用情况,优化资源分配以提升系统性能。可扩展性评估系统在增加或减少硬件资源时的表现,优化系统以实现更好的可扩展性。系统性能评估与优化安全性评估评估系统对外部攻击的防御能力,确保系统的安全性。稳定性评估评估系统在各种使用场景下的稳定性,确保系统的可靠性。故障恢复能力评估系统在出现故障时的恢复能力,确保系统的高可用性。加密与认证评估系统对敏感信息的保护措施,确保数据的安全性。系统安全与稳定性评估07总结与展望123收获掌握了车辆租赁管理系统的基本原理和流程。学会了如何进行需求分析、系统设计、编码和测试。课程设计的收获与不足提高了团队合作和沟通能力。对数据库设计和软件工程有了更深入的理解。课程设计的收获与不足02030401课程设计的收获与不足不足时间安排不够合理,导致部分功能开发不够完善。测试阶段不够充分,有些潜在问题未被发现。团队协作中存在一些沟通障碍,影响了开发效率。展望进一步完善车辆租赁管理系统,增加更多功能模块。将系统应用于实际场景,进行大规模测试和优化。对未来工作的展望与建议0102对未来工作的展望与建议将系统推广到更多企业,实现商业
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2024年度国际物流行业动态试题及答案
- 江淮地区软质小麦轻简化丰产栽培技术
- 典型家具产品阶段流程示例
- 2019年辽宁省鞍山市中考化学试卷(解析)
- 血清阴性干燥综合征2025
- 动物的生殖行为与繁殖策略试题及答案
- 生态学与保护生物学试题及答案
- 进化生物学的研究现状与挑战试题及答案
- 学习节奏国际物流师试题及答案
- 保健植物知识培训课件
- 云南省历年专升本地理学概论真题及答案
- 近代物理实验报告-铁磁共振
- 写字楼保洁服务投标方案
- 科学课程标准测试真题卷及答案2022年版(义务教育)
- 作文-曼娜回忆录全文小说
- IPC-1601印制板操作和贮存指南英文版
- 良种基地建设-母树林(林木种苗生产技术)
- 道路危险货物运输行业安全生产管理培训教材(PPT 58张)
- 新生儿早期基本保健(EENC)指南要点解读
- DB13T 5654-2023 补充耕地符合性评定与质量等级评价技术规程
- BPW250-6.3K2型喷雾泵泵组随机图册(二泵一箱)
评论
0/150
提交评论